Why Local Expertise Matters

Lakewood's position at the base of the Front Range creates unique gutter challenges. Spring brings heavy runoff from snowmelt, summer afternoon thunderstorms dump intense rainfall, and freeze-thaw cycles stress mounting hardware.

15 inches of annual rainfall + 60 inches of snow + freeze-thaw stress = gutters that work harder than most.

We've cleaned gutters in 1960s ranch homes across Applewood, new construction near Belmar, and split-levels in Kendrick Lake. We know how mature cottonwoods and aspens shed seeds and leaves twice yearly—and how Colorado's dry air makes organic buildup break down into a sticky sludge.

Our crews understand that gutters on Green Mountain slopes handle more runoff than flat neighborhoods. We pitch and secure systems to handle it, and we pressure-wash with restraint so composite decks and older siding stay protected.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should gutters be cleaned in Lakewood?

Fall (October–November) and spring (April–May) are critical. Most homes need 2–3 cleanings yearly due to cottonwood seeds in spring and oak leaves in fall. If you have gutter guards, once yearly is usually enough.

Will you work on homes with HOA rules in Belmar or Applewood?

Yes. Many Lakewood neighborhoods have HOA guidelines on gutter materials and colors. We follow local restrictions and coordinate with your community before starting any repair or replacement work.

Is pressure washing safe for older siding?

We use low pressure (1200–1500 PSI) and adjust based on material. Older wood siding, composites, and stucco all require different techniques. We inspect first and let you know if pressure washing is safe for your home.

What gutter materials work best in Colorado's climate?

Seamless aluminum is the most popular—affordable, durable, and handles freeze-thaw cycles well. Copper lasts 50+ years but costs more. Avoid seamed sectional gutters; they leak as cold cracks the joints.

Do gutter guards really work in Lakewood?

Yes, if installed correctly. Guards block seeds and leaves but let water through. In heavy storms, they don't clog. They cut cleaning frequency from 3+ times yearly to 1–2, saving money and roof-climbing risk long term.

What if my gutters are leaking or sagging?

We assess the damage during our inspection. Small leaks can be patched; sagging gutters get re-secured or sectioned replaced. If gutters are over 20 years old, replacement with seamless aluminum is often the most cost-effective long-term solution.
